The reintroduction of wolves in the year 1995 increased biodiversity in Yellowstone National Park by suppressing elk and coyote populations, allowing revegetation of stream and river banks.

The United States and China did not ratify the Kyoto Protocol, which likely limited the scope and impact of the agreement’s impact on the reduction of greenhouse gas emissions.
